A Scarborough postie has recorded his own Christmas Song, complete with a locally filmed video.
Luke Barker says the song started out as an entry for a staff competition at the post office.
Members of staff were asked to send videos of them selves singing their favourite Christmas song.
Luke decided to take it several steps further writing and performing his own song and then filming an accompanying video feature post office colleagues and filmed largely in Scarborough.
